What is a common feature of thunderstorms?
Back
They involve lightning, thunder, heavy rain, and sometimes hail.

What is a characteristic of a hurricane?
Back
It forms over warm ocean waters and has a well-defined eye.

What best describes an air mass?
Back
A large body of air with uniform temperature and humidity. The characteristics of the air are based on where it forms.

How can the interaction between air masses lead to severe weather?
Back
The collision of air masses can lead to instability, due to differences in air temperature, and this leads to severe weather.

What conditions are necessary for a hurricane to form?
Back
Warm ocean waters, moist air, and low wind shear.
